6* CommonKnowledge: It's widely stated that Spike's inability to recall much of the previous series or events leading up to this one is due to TheFogOfAges. But in the actual episode it's stated that it was due to his only recently awakening from a century-long sleep, with Hitch noting his memories are similarly fuzzy right after waking up.

18* SalvagedStory: A criticism of ''WesternAnimation/MyLittlePonyFriendshipIsMagic'' was earth ponies seeming lack of [[MagicAIsMagicA the well-defined magic]] like [[MindOverMatter unicorns]] or [[{{Flight}} pegasi]], as their WordOfGod-stated connection to nature [[InformedAbility wasn't clearly demonstrated]] and SuperStrength shown only by a few individuals or inconsistently. ''Make Your Mark'' rectified this by granting earth ponies GreenThumb abilities, even making it a plot point that magic has evolved to explain why earth ponies never had this power before.

21* UncertainAudience: For returning/older audiences of ''[[WesternAnimation/MyLittlePonyFriendshipIsMagic Friendship Is Magic]]'' and/or ''[[WesternAnimation/MyLittlePonyANewGeneration A New Generation]]'' it was seen as [[ToughActToFollow failing to live up to their writing quality]], and lacking enough continuity with '' Friendship Is Magic'' to justify being its SequelSeries but enough to displease those who wouldn't have minded if it was a separate series. Meanwhile the new/younger audiences who wouldn't care about these issues or would not be picky about quality were inclined to ignore ''Make Your Mark'' in favor of the ''[[WebAnimation/MyLittlePonyTellYourTale Tell Your Tale]]'' spinoff for its [[DenserAndWackier cartoony style]] and greater accessibility (more episodic, far more frequent releases, not being locked in a subscription service). Thus ''Make Your Mark'' [[https://www.equestriadaily.com/2024/02/make-your-mark-chapter-6-was-final.html wasn't renewed after its initial run]] while ''Tell Your Tale'' [[https://www.equestriadaily.com/2023/06/everything-that-was-revealed-in-mlp.html?m=1 was because it better appealed to a specific audience]].
